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$3,176 in Zofingen versus $2,359 in Barcelona.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$4,776 in Zofingen versus $3,498 in Barcelona.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$6,376 in Zofingen versus $4,638 in Barcelona.

Living in Zofingen is roughly 35% more expensive than in Barcelona, driven mainly by Eating Out.

Both cities are pricier than the global median: Zofingen 139% above, Barcelona 77% above.

Cost Breakdown

A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$1,729 in Zofingen and $1,524 in Barcelona.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.

Zofingen pays 215% more on average. The extra income cushions the higher costs, though housing choices and lifestyle decide how much of the gap is truly closed.

Dining out: $106 in Zofingen vs $68.0 in Barcelona for a mid-range dinner for two. Groceries echo the gap at $423 vs $319 per month, with Barcelona cheaper across the board.
